Tengo Una Disfunción Con Un Error De Que SSIS No Se Convierte Entre Unicode Y No Unicode

Finalmente puede dejar atrás las preocupaciones de solución de problemas de su PC. La mejor herramienta de reparación de Windows para cualquier problema.

A veces, su computadora puede presentar un mensaje que dice que la conversión entre Unicode y no Unicode no fue un error posible para SSIS . Este problema puede tener muchos problemas.La única diferencia entre Unicode y las alternativas que no son Unicode es si el tipo OAWCHAR es char para archivos de conocimiento de caracteres o char para datos web personales. Los argumentos de longitud siempre especifican un número avanzado de caracteres, no una variedad de bytes.

Cuando los datos se transfieren indudablemente de un sistema a otra persona, generalmente hay diferentes tipos con datos entre y la causa deseada de división. En este arrastre de almacén de datos, la fuente es un jimmy nvarchar, y cada uno de nuestros objetivos es normalmente un varchar. El autor del artículo de datos de almacén decidió utilizar una variante de hechos diferente por motivos de rendimiento. El problema estrictamente en SQL Server Integration Services (SSIS) con respecto a este caso se vuelve detectable solo cuando la columna de causa altamente coincidente se almacena realmente como el destino más reciente en una columna de componente OLE DB de destino. una vez

Si crean una fuente OLE en una fantástica base de datos SSIS y agregan T-SQL diseñado para la mayor parte de la recuperación de datos, generalmente el tipo de datos se puede recuperar proveniente de la tabla fuente y también se puede guardar en la columna de entrada /exit condominios. Puede usar el componente de datos de conversión de SSIS para convertir un nvarchar significativo en varchar. Pero estudiemos otra opción para mover un tipo de ancho de banda. En este experimento, aprenderá sobre las propiedades de los componentes fuente de E/S.

Esta tabla de ejemplo considera los productos utilizados, las transacciones utilizadas en esa información de AdventureWorks y la versión del almacén de pruebas de la tabla de evaluación de productos. Puede descargar estas listas proporcionadas por codeplex.

Preparar un programa muy es muy simple. En primer lugar, se trunca la tabla de espera para una dimensión sin problemas. Los datos probablemente se transfieran a un común intermedio. La figura muestra una tarea de rendimiento general de SQL (truncamiento de la tabla de principiantes avanzados) y un procedimiento de flujo de datos adicional (ordenar los datos de medición de precios).

La tarea de flujo de archivos de datos en la fig. 2 ofrece un componente OLE DB de origen que pasa muchas estadísticas al componente OLE DB de destino.

Reparación de PC rápida y sencilla

Presentamos Reimage: el software indispensable para cualquiera que confíe en su computadora. Esta poderosa aplicación reparará rápida y fácilmente cualquier error común, protegerá sus archivos contra pérdida o corrupción, lo protegerá contra malware y fallas de hardware, y optimizará su PC para obtener el máximo rendimiento. Entonces, ya sea estudiante, madre ocupada, propietario de una pequeña empresa o jugador, ¡Reimage es para usted!

  • Paso 1: Descargue e instale el software Reimage
  • Paso 2: Abra el software y haga clic en "Escanear"
  • Paso 3: Haga clic en "Restaurar" para iniciar el proceso de restauración

  • Simple T-SQL cumple con 3) para (imagen del componente original. La fuente OLE DB es el componente que identifica las columnas 7 Producción. Producto que en SQL es una propiedad de la instrucción by, no directamente en el rendimiento Dado que solo necesitamos esta copia, 5 paquetes funcionarán mejor suponiendo que practiquemos y nos apeguemos a prácticas óptimas como T-SQL.

    seleccionado

    Qué es ahora Unicode y no Unicode en SQL?

    Un carácter Unicode sencillo toma más bytes para almacenar todo el origen de la base de datos. Por otro lado, las páginas de reglas que no son Unicode, así como muchos otros idiomas asiáticos útiles, especifican el almacenamiento de diseño durante los sistemas de caracteres de doble byte (DBCS). Por lo tanto, en nombre de estos idiomas ahora hay garantía de que no hay diferencia en el almacenamiento, Unicode y Unicode casi correctos.

    Varios: T-SQL para recopilar productos de la base de datos de origen.

    Después de que la mayoría decidió inyectar T-SQL inmediatamente en el OLE DB original en la (Figura 4), las definiciones de datos de entrada lejos de la sección de origen se utilizan para definir cada ruta de transformación. En esta posición, el nvarchar de la producción se considera usado. La tabla Product siempre se puede utilizar como un tipo de datos. Los tipos de evidencia de Nvarchar se convierten al modelo particular que no es Unicode en SSIS para las columnas de participación y los resultados.

    En la secuencia de tablas de la fig. 5a usa mi estilo de datos varchar para ProductName, ProductAlternativeKey, Color Size y. fuente nvarchar. Así como 6)(asignamos el contenido de este tipo de imagen al servicio SSIS, podemos obtener un buen error.

    CREAR TABLA dbo.stageProducts( [id del producto] entero, [nombre del producto] varchar(50), [Clave alternativa del producto] varchar(25), [color] varchar(15), [Precio de lista] dinero, [tamaño] varchar(5), [ProductSubcategoryID] entero)

    Después de hacer clic en Aceptar, aparece el error “Es posible que la columna ProductName no convierta el punto en el que provienen los tipos de línea Unicode y no Unicode especificados”, como se muestra dentro de la Figura 1-3. 7.

    no se puede traducir entre unicode y un error de unicode en ssis

    Ahora, en lugar de configurar un componente de transformación de datos entre nuestros componentes de origen y de destino, T-SQL en todos los componentes de origen OLEDB se anula para usar la función CAST para finalmente convertir las columnas origins nvarchar a varchar. Véase la figura. 8.

    SELECCIONE [ProductID], CAST([Name] AS VARCHAR(50)) COMO nombre de la aplicación     ,CAST([ProductNumber] AS VARCHAR(25)) AS productalternatekey    ,CAST([color] AS AS varchar(15)) color,[precio de lista]        ,CAST( [tamaño] AS VARCHAR(5)) AS tamaño         ,[ID de subcategoría de producto]  SALIDA [Producción].[Producto]

    Al colocar un CAST para copiar normalmente el tipo de datos nvarchar con “as varchar(xx)”, todos estos componentes personalizados normalmente transmitirán los datos al canal apropiado. Teniendo en cuenta que los tipos de datos se extrajeron al principio del T-SQL original, es necesario cambiar los parámetros de repuesto del componente OLE DB original. Necesitamos ayuda para hacer el software manualmente.

    Al hacer clic con el botón derecho en el componente real en el que se encuentra este componente de origen (Fig. 9), se activa cualquier menú especial para seleccionar Mostrar en el Editor avanzado…

    Una vez allí, consulte las propiedades de entrada y salida y, como consecuencia, seleccione las columnas de salida. ProductName, Color productalternatekey y Size deberían cambiarse de un cable Unicode (DT_WSTR) a una cadena (DT_STR) como se muestra en la figura diez y 11.

    no se puede convertir en un error entre unicode y no unicode dentro de solo ssis

    Después de repetir la mayoría de los mensajes nvarchar anteriores para esto, el error desaparece, como se muestra en la Figura 12.

    ¿Cómo podría resolver el problema de datos Unicode pero no Unicode al importar datos de Excel a SQL Server?

    Seleccione la columna de servicio para la que está buscando un error.Su tipo de datos debería ser “String[DT_STR]”.Cambie terriblemente el tipo de datos que String[DT_WSTR]” puede usar “unicode.

    Si bien es posible encontrar una importante conversión de beans de información para convertir datos de diferentes tipos, este método ayuda a mantener su lógica actual por encima de T-SQL. Este enfoque no solo es una opción para la conversión de datos de beans de datos, lamentablemente también le brinda la oportunidad de aprender sobre el acceso más avanzado del componente original.

    ¿Cómo convierto Unicode a SSIS?

    Necesitamos tiempo para agregar la tarea de convertir los datos SSIS del autor entre la causa de Excel y estos objetivos OLE DB. Esto convierte los datos Unicode originales para permitir que no sean Unicode. Si hace doble clic en el elemento Transformar, sus requisitos ahora pueden decirle lo que realmente desea convertir.

    ¿Preocupado por el rendimiento de su computadora? Relájate y deja que Reimage se encargue de todo.

    Cannot Convert Between Unicode And Non Unicode Error In Ssis
    Konvertieren Zwischen Unicode Und Nicht-Unicode-Fehler In Ssis Nicht Möglich
    Ssis에서 유니코드와 비유니코드 오류 간에 변환할 수 없음
    Impossible De Convertir Entre L’erreur Unicode Et Non Unicode Dans Ssis
    Impossibile Convertire Tra Errore Unicode E Non Unicode In Ssis
    Kan Inte Konvertera Mellan Unicode Och Non Unicode-fel I Ssis
    Nie Można Przekonwertować Między Błędem Unicode I Innym Niż Unicode W Ssis
    Не удается преобразовать между Unicode и ошибкой, отличной от Unicode, в Ssis
    Não é Possível Converter Entre Unicode E Erro Não Unicode No Ssis
    Kan Niet Converteren Tussen Unicode En Niet Unicode-fout In Ssis